Transaction 584a0599f626f213a87958e2214c19113dc70d6585ef0c7018eefc54a2883716

1 Input
2 Outputs
  • 584a0599f626f213a87958e2214c19113dc70d6585ef0c7018eefc54a2883716:0
  • value  187952
    address  3PTxBT6goiXR84JNpDfK4mthHqPSK2jpYJ
  • 584a0599f626f213a87958e2214c19113dc70d6585ef0c7018eefc54a2883716:1
  • value  565239
    address  18e6HC7d8KeqGBpD8huxh6ZxCaMMMSndW8